Distributed ledger technology and Fair Play in Gaming

The introduction of blockchain technology in the gambling industry has revolutionized the way gamblers perceive equity and openness. Conventional casino games often come under examination due to the potential lack of accountability from the house. With blockchain, every transaction is logged on a distributed ledger, ensuring that game outcomes are both confirmable and immutable. This transparency creates a level of trust between gamblers and operators, making it easier for them to be assured that they are being treated fairly.
In addition, smart contracts, a feature of this system, enable self-executing and safe processes in gameplay. These agreements can govern the parameters of a game, automatically process payouts, and oversee player rewards without the need for a central authority. This adds another layer of trust, as players can verify that the guidelines are being followed, reducing the chances of deception or cheating. As more digital gambling platforms start to implement these advancements, players can enjoy an enhanced gaming experience that prioritizes equity.
